Exp < /strong>eriments were carried out to investigate the toxic effects of the aquatic herbicide "Diquat" on two of most familiar Egyptian Nile fish Clarias lazera and Tilapia nilo tica. The Len of diquat on Tilapia nilotica was 200 (166-250) ppm. Short-term toxicity studies were carried out on both types of fish by daily inocula ting 1/10 LC dose for five weeks. Symptoms, post-mortem and Histopathological changes were observed. Our investigation revealed a significant decrease in RBCS. WBCs. count and Hb concentration during short term toxicity study.
